Executive Summary of Organic Photodetector Market

The global Organic Photodetector (OPD) market is experiencing robust growth, projected to expand from $163.301 million in 2021 to $910.874 million by 2033, registering a compound annual growth rate (CAGR) of 15.4%. This expansion is fueled by the increasing demand for flexible, lightweight, and cost-effective sensor technologies in various high-growth sectors. Key applications driving this adoption include consumer electronics, such as smartphones with under-display sensors, and the healthcare industry, particularly in wearable health monitors and advanced medical imaging systems. The unique properties of OPDs, such as their tuneable spectral response and suitability for large-area fabrication, position them as a compelling alternative to traditional inorganic photodetectors. While North America currently leads the market, the Asia Pacific region is poised for rapid growth, driven by its expansive electronics manufacturing ecosystem. Challenges related to material stability and competition from mature silicon-based technologies remain, but ongoing research and development are continuously pushing the boundaries of OPD performance and commercial viability.

What is Organic Photodetector?

Organic photodetectors (OPDs) are devices that convert light into an electrical signal. They are made using organic materials, such as polymers or small molecules, which have the ability to absorb light and generate charge carriers, such as electrons and holes. There are two types of organic photodetectors such as photon-based organic photodetector, and thermal organic photodetector.
Organic photodetectors (OPDs) are gaining momentum due to their various advantages, such as tunability of detecting wavelength, low cost, compatibility with lightweight and flexible devices, as well as ease of processing. They can be used in a wide range of applications, such as in photovoltaics, environmental monitoring, imaging sensors, and optical communications. They are also widely used in radiometry and photometry to calculate properties, such as optical strength, luminous flux, optical intensity, and irradiance, in combination with other methods for properties, including radiance.
OPDs operate by absorbing photons of light and generating charge carriers, which are then transported to electrodes, where they are collected and converted into an electrical signal. The efficiency of an OPD depends on several factors, such as the absorption spectrum of the organic material, the charge carrier mobility, and the device architecture.
